Transaction 59707e2930a0fb8df9fdc99594da50a978ceeab5e74b1e95c080bbd0bfcb84a9

1 Input
2 Outputs
  • 59707e2930a0fb8df9fdc99594da50a978ceeab5e74b1e95c080bbd0bfcb84a9:0
  • value  13088626
    address  16SjKcP5ch24MJhr9XDmq27fpGc7dZsZa3
  • 59707e2930a0fb8df9fdc99594da50a978ceeab5e74b1e95c080bbd0bfcb84a9:1
  • value  1395520968
    address  1HiSpTsy3XPohh84ApZ4pMgrAYVWjWPGnH